What is IRS Form 2119?

IRS Form 2119 is a crucial tax document in the United States, specifically designed for reporting the sale of a primary residence. This form allows taxpayers to detail personal information and information regarding their home sale, including gain or loss calculations. Understanding the requirements of IRS Form 2119 is essential for compliance with U.S. tax laws.
This tax form holds significant relevance for taxpayers, particularly those who are looking to claim the one-time exclusion of gain for individuals aged 55 or older. Correct filing can also impact tax liabilities and potential refunds.

Who Needs to File IRS Form 2119?

IRS Form 2119 must be filed by individuals who have sold their primary residence during the tax year. Both taxpayers and their spouses need to understand their roles in the filing process, especially when filing jointly.
File this form if you meet certain eligibility criteria, such as realizing gains from the sale of your primary residence or qualifying for the exclusion based on age. Understanding these scenarios will help clarify when the filing of Form 2119 is necessary.

When and How to Submit IRS Form 2119

Taxpayers must file IRS Form 2119 alongside their Form 1040 for the year in which the home was sold. Key deadlines include the regular tax filing deadline, usually April 15, unless extended through available provisions.
